Legal Issues in Real Estate Foreclosure Training Seminar
Safeguard Your Clients' Interests During A Foreclosure Action
As a representative for either side of a foreclosure action, you need to be able to assertively protect your clients' financial interests. Fulfilling that objective requires both an in-depth understanding of the foreclosure process, and strategies for overcoming the problems that often arise. How do your knowledge and skills stack up? Our accomplished presenters will give you practical procedural pointers to expedite the process, and share their solutions for many of the problems you'll face. Gain the benefits of their years of experience so you can ensure adequate protection, streamline the process and reduce loss for your clients - enroll today!
- Ensure free and clear title to expedite the foreclosure sale and the distribution of proceeds.
- Be able to obtain marketable title when discrepancies in legal descriptions of the land arise.
- Avoid foreclosure proceedings: use workout options to save clients time, trouble and money.
- Assert your clients' rights regarding homeowner association liens and fees when a common interest property is in foreclosure.
- Understand how the new bankruptcy rules - and other relevant law updates - impact the foreclosures you're working on.
- Speed up the process and avoid missing steps using our checklists during foreclosure procedures.
- Determine if manufactured homes are personal or real property for foreclosure purposes.
- Avoid lawsuits arising from inadvertent violations of the FDCPA.

Agenda |
|
| |
- CURRENT CASE LAW AND LEGISLATIVE UPDATE
S. Joel Johnson, 9:00 - 9:30
- Recent State and Federal Legislation and Current Statutes Governing Foreclosure
- Important Case Decisions That May Affect Your Practice
- Uniform Commercial Code
- Rules Revisions on the Postponement of Sales
- FORECLOSURE AVOIDANCE OPTIONS
S. Joel Johnson, 9:30 - 10:15
- Loss Mitigation Solutions
- Reinstatement Options
- Disposition Options
- NON-JUDICIAL FORECLOSURE PROCEDURE
Bradley P. Jones, 10:15 - 11:15
- Necessary Documents to Proceed With Foreclosure
- Appointment of Successor Trustee
- Notice of Default/Notice of Acceleration
- Title Examination/Title Issues
- Non-Judicial Process
- Bidding Strategies
- At the Sale
- Funds at Sale - Distribution, Surplus Deficiency
- Right of Redemption
- How to Cure a Defective Sale
- Sample Generic Procedure Checklist Overview - Steps to Avoid Liability Exposure
- JUDICIAL FORECLOSURE PROCEDURE
Jill D. Rein, 11:30 - 12:30
- Reasons for Proceeding Judicially
- Causes of Action
- Necessary Documents to Proceed with Foreclosure
- Title Examination/Title Issues
- The Petition
- Service of Process
- Judgment
- The Sale
- Funds at Sale - Distribution, Surplus Deficiency
- Right of Redemption
- Confirmation of Sale
- How to Cure a Defective Sale
- Sample Generic Procedure Checklist Overview - Steps to Avoid Liability Exposure
- EVICTION
Jill D. Rein, 1:30 - 2:00
- Securing Property Pre-Sale
- Occupied vs. Vacant
- Eviction Procedure
- Effect of Vacancy on Redemption
- Unknown Occupants
- ETHICAL CONSIDERATIONS IN FORECLOSURE
S. Joel Johnson, 2:00 - 3:00
- Applying the Rules of Professional Conduct
- Avoiding Conflicts of Interest
- Good Faith Deposits
- HOT TOPICS AND COMMON PROBLEM AREAS ADDRESSED
Bradley P. Jones, 3:15 - 4:00
- Manufactured Housing
- Condominium and Homeowners' Associations Liens
- Fair Debt Collection Practices Act
- Real Estate Settlement Procedures Act
- Contested Estate Administration Proceedings
- Procedures for Excess Proceeds
- Foreclosure in Divorce (Transfer of Title, QDROs, Apportionment of Equity, etc.)
- Analysis of Financial Data and Tax Ramifications
- Business Valuations and Apportionment (Stock, Capital, Inventory)
- Discrepancies in Legal Descriptions of the Land
- Reassessment of Damages
- Handling Your Client's Emotional Distress
- How to Deal With Ejectments
- HOW DO NEW BANKRUPTCY RULES AFFECT FORECLOSURE?
Bradley P. Jones, 4:00 - 4:30
- Automatic Stay Rules and Their Interpretation by the Courts
- Chapters 7, 11 and 13
- Proofs of Claim
- Motions for Relief
- Bankruptcy Reform

Audience |
|
| |
This is a basic-to-intermediate level seminar designed specifically for creditor and debtor attorneys who are interested in practical and legal solutions to the problems associated with foreclosure and repossession. Paralegals will also find this program valuable.
